Will you share our vision as our new: “Technical Safety & Reliability (TS&R) Engineer”?
The TS&R engineer will fulfil a role within the Technical Safety & Reliability function, responsible for supporting and guiding the identification, development, and implementation of technical safety & reliability scope in tenders, FEED, project execution and general product support.
Accountabilities / Responsibilities:
Main accountabilities
- Provide input to FEED, tenders and projects concerning the choice of technical solutions in compliance with safety and reliability requirements
- Establish, execute and follow up the Engineering Safety and Reliability program for projects, including SIL verification wok, FMECA, RAM, HAZOP, HAZID, etc.
- SIL verification and certification of safety instrumented systems in accordance with IEC 61508 and IEC 61511.
- System reviews and analyses to assess technical safety and reliability
- Clarifications with customer in the area of technical safety and reliability
- Follow up product development and improvements to ensure compliance with safety and reliability requirements
- Analyzing reliability data for products with the use of statistical methods and to use this as platform for product and system improvements
Profile requirements:
Main requirements
- MSc, BEng or equivalent
- Experience within reliability, availability, maintainability, and safety (RAMS) analyses
- Experience with Safety integrity level (SIL) verifications in accordance with IEC 61508 and IEC 61511
- Knowledge of production availability analyses (in accordance with ISO 20815)
- Good skills in English language, both written and verbal
- Capable of leading teams
Additional requirements (as an advantage)
- Subsea oil, gas and process industry experience
- Be able to facilitate HAZOP and FMECA assessments
- Knowledge in MAROS, Fault Tree software Project experience
